New Linux Kernel Rules Put The Onus On Humans For AI Tool Usage
Hackaday reports that Linux kernel documentation now formally allows AI coding tools, while keeping maintainers and submitters responsible for reviewing, understanding, and standing behind any machine-assisted patches.
